Manual EQ - equalizer setting
Manual adjustment of 10 band equalizer (from -9 dB to +9 dB).
Tuning is possible at frequencies: 32 / 64 / 125 / 250 / 500 Hz / 1 / 2 / 4 / 8 / 15 kHz
AUDIO - sound settings
Main functions
Preset EQ - equalizer preset.
Values: User / Flat / Classic / Rock / Pop / Jazz / Country
X-Bass
Turns on and adjusts the bass boost (OFF / LOW / HI).
Loudness
Turns on / off loudness.
Subwoofer
Turns on / off the subwoofer.
Fader
Adjusts the relative volume between front and back speakers.
Balance
Adjusts the relative volume between left and rights speakers.

Radio
Range selection
Press the button (7) BND to select the broadcasting range
of radio stations: FM1, FM2, Fm3.
Saving and recalling radio stations
Press and hold one of the number buttons (1-6) to store the current radio station.
Press one of the number buttons (1-6) to recall the current radio station.
It is possible to store 6 radio stations in each broadcasting range.
Automatic station search
Press the button (9) or (2) to quickly search for stations.
Search and save stations automatically
Press and hold the BND button (3) for more than 2 seconds.
The unit will quickly search for and automatically save18 FM
radio stations with strong signals.
Manual station search
Press and hold the button (9) or (2) for more than 2 seconds to
switch to manual setting mode.
Press button (9) or (2) to change the frequency step by step.
Hold down the button (9) or (2) to change the frequency step by step.

BLUETOOTH
Pairing with your phone
Pair your phone with the AMH-600BT receiver:
1. Turn on Bluetooth on your mobile device.
2. Find “AMH-600BT” in the list of available BT devices and connect to it.
PIN-code for authorization: 1234.
3. In case of successful connection, the “BT” indicator on the display of the receiver
will stop blinking and will light up constantly.
4. The audio signal from the mobile device (music and calls) will be transmitted to
the car speakers.
Outcoming call
Dial the subscriber's number on your phone. The call will be made through
the speakerphone.
Incoming call
When an incoming call arrives, the caller's number will be displayed on the
receiver's screen. Press the button (7) to receive the speakerphone call.

13
End call
To reject an incoming call or end a conversation, press and
hold the button (7) .
Switch between phone and speakerphone
During a call, press the button (7) to transfer the audio signal from the
speakerphone to your phone or from the phone to the speakerphone.
Calling the last dialed number
Press and hold the button (7) on the receiver to call the last number in the list
of outgoing calls on your phone.
Press the button (7) on the receiver to activate the Siri function.
Volume control
Rotate the volume knob during a call to adjust the volume level.
Press the button (15) to mute the sound.
Bluetooth music (A2DP)
The AMH-600BT receiver supports the Bluetooth A2DP audio transmission protocol.
After successfully pairing your mobile device with the receiver, you will be able
to play music from your phone on the car audio system.
To switch tracks, press buttons (9) or (2) .
To stop playback, press the button (19) .
